Description
The LTC2925 is a power supply tracking controller that provides a simple solution for power supply tracking and sequencing requirements. It can control the outputs of three independent supplies without inserting any pass element losses. For systems that require a fourth supply, or when a supply does not allow direct access to its feedback resistors, one supply can be controlled with a series FET. The LTC2925 also includes a power good timeout feature that turns off the supplies if an external supply monitor fails to indicate that the supplies have entered regulation within an adjustable timeout period.
Features
Flexible power supply tracking up and down
Power supply sequencing
Supply stability is not affected
Controls three supplies without series FETs
Controls an optional fourth supply with a series FET
Electronic circuit breaker
Remote sense switch compensates for voltage drop across a series FET
Supply shutdown outputs
FAULT output
Adjustable power good timeout
Available in narrow 24-lead SSOP and tiny 24-lead QFN packages
Applications
VCORE and V0 supply tracking
Microprocessor, DSP, and FPGA supplies
Servers
Communication systems
